pcb ontwerp van begin tot einde

***ouder topic, toevoeging pag 6, niet hele topic opnieuw lezen***

ik zit met een hele kleine oplage printjes die ik zou moeten maken. een schieldje voor op een arduino nano.

nu mag dat evengoed thru hole als smd (niet te klein) zijn. allemaal op gaatjesprint maken zie ik even niet zitten.
nu zit er maar bitterweinig op, voor dit moment. er moet wat bijkomen en de gaatjes print is er minder voor geschikt, daarom wil ik graag pcb maken.

1) ik teken al ongeveer 20jaar geen schemas meer op pc
2) pcb ontwerp, daar mag je vlotjes 24jaar van maken
3) online bestellen van dergelijke heb ik nog nooit gedaan (ik maakte mijn pcb vroeger nog met toner transfert en oplossen in één of ander bruin vlekkemakend spul (waterstofperoxide met nog iets bij? k denk dat het beter is om online te bestellen. oplage mag 5 tot 20 stuks zijn. hoeft niet 1 te zijn, maar ook geen 100den.

het schema bestaat nu uit een 8tal weerstanden, een schakelaar en een I2C display.
naar de toekomst toe moet er nog een TL431a bij met weerstandje(s) en misschien ook functionaliteit naar SPI display. aangezien display toch met draden zit verbonden, kan ik dan evengoed er manueel bijzetten.
belangrijk in die software is wel dat ik het bestand kan saven, en later nog kan aanpassen voor een V2 te maken.

en wie wil weten wat het is.
ik heb mijn digitale dashboard van mijn oude golf geminimaliseerd en zodanig opgebouwd dat je die kan wegwerken in een 'schakelaargat afdekplaatje'.
https://www.youtube.com/watch?v=Dd4ngVawa3o&ab_channel=AndyDevuyst
is nog in ontwikkeling, wil naar iets breder scherm (80x160 ipv 32x128 pixels)
en aangezien ik het wel wil monteren in meerdere van mijn autos, vandaar dus 5 printjes (minimum al)

ik hou van werken ..., ik kan er uren naar kijken

met welke software kan ik het schema tekenen en pcb ontwerp mee maken die een pcb fabrikant kan verwerken.
hierbij van belang dat ik dus de footprint van een nano moet hebben in de librarys...
ik zou al gaan tekenen in paint en toner transfer gaan gebruiken, maar vermoed dat de chinees met die tekening niks kan doen

ik hou van werken ..., ik kan er uren naar kijken

Ok, dat is duidelijk.

Voor open source is KiCAD handig, het kost in elk geval niets, maar het is niet het makkelijkste om mee te leren werken. Er zijn online veel footprints te vinden, en versie 6 schijnt best aardig mee te werken te zijn.

Ik kan me herinneren dat bigclivedotcom het ooit had over een pakket waarmee je pads en tracks kon tekenen, wat een stuk laagdrempeliger is. Ik zal even kijken of ik dat kan vinden.

edit: Hij noemt "Sprint layout 50", maar ik heb er geen persoonlijke ervaring mee.

kicad aan het downloaden, morgen op werk een poging om mijn schema erin te krijgen (remote desktop)

ik hou van werken ..., ik kan er uren naar kijken
PE9SMS

Golden Member

Sprint Layout zou ik alleen naar kijken als dit echt een eenmalig project is. Als je denkt in de toekomst vaker pcb's te maken dan zou ik zeker voor Kicad gaan. Kicad werkt volgens de gebruikelijke flow van schema naar pcb (wat fouten voorkomt) en is inmiddels een erg degelijk pakket. Sprint Layout werkt (dacht ik) zonder onderliggende netlist, dus vrij tekenen zeg maar, heel goed opletten dus.

This signature is intentionally left blank.

sprint layout zou voor die speciaal werkje dus ook nog kunnen. ik heb maar een 20lijntjes in gebruik

ik hou van werken ..., ik kan er uren naar kijken

Ik was net te snel met afsluiten. Kijk eens bij https://fritzing.org/projects/
hier kun je heel laagdrempelig beginnen. Je kunt de boards via hun site laten maken, maar ze zijn ook te exporteren voor andere fabrikanten

Ik heb je filmpjes bekeken, leuk gemaakt joh !

bprosman

Golden Member

Als je het schema ergens hebt wil ik (met Kicad) wel een duwtje geven.

De jongere generatie loopt veel te vaak zijn PIC achterna.

Dat klinkt als een sympathiek aanbod!

Op 3 februari 2022 20:46:21 schreef Twest:
Ik was net te snel met afsluiten. Kijk eens bij https://fritzing.org/projects/
hier kun je heel laagdrempelig beginnen. Je kunt de boards via hun site laten maken, maar ze zijn ook te exporteren voor andere fabrikanten

Fritzing schijnt vrij omstreden te zijn of het je goede ontwerppraktijken aanleert. Ik heb er zelf geen ervaring mee, maar het doet me twijfelen om het mensen aan te raden.

Ziet er super uit.
Als je vroeger al op de pc printjes ontwierp.
Zal het wel snel weer kunnen oppikken.
En voor vragen staan we altijd open.

Meten=Weten. Weet wat je meet.

Als ik zou willen leren ontwerpen zou ik het niet gebruiken. Maar als ik één project wil doen met snel resultaat zonder flinke leercurve heb ik er geen probleem mee. En dat idee proefde ik een beetje in de vraag.

benleentje

Golden Member

1) ik teken al ongeveer 20jaar geen schemas meer op pc
2) pcb ontwerp, daar mag je vlotjes 24jaar van maken

Ik had nog nooit een pcb getekend. IK ben zelf begonnen met Eagle, voor zover ik kon zien de meest uitgebreide bibliotheek en tot 80cm2 dubbelzijdig, onbeperkte pinnen en bijna alle tools zijn ook te gebruiken en ook auto-routing ed.

Om te beginnen even de een tutorial gevolgd "Getting started with eagle 9.6" en alles meteen duidelijk. Voor een eigen component bijmaken nog een 2de tutorial en je kan vrijwel alles met egagle doen.

Leuke aan Eagle vind ik dat als je later je schema aanpast en componenten erbij die automatisch er ook gelijk op de PCB bijkomen of veranderd worden.

doen met snel resultaat zonder flinke leercurve

Daar was ik eerst bang voor met eagle maar de getting started was toch ruim voldoende en vrijwel alles in het programma werkt zo intuitief dat ik er eigenlijk meteen in thuis was.

Een component bijmaken lukt eerst niet maar na een tutorial was ook dat weer duidelijk, ik deed het bijna goed alleen er moest blijkbaar nog een stap tussen.

[Bericht gewijzigd door benleentje op donderdag 3 februari 2022 22:51:39 (22%)

Ik zou Altium Circuitmaker adviseren. Dat is gratis voor een paar ontwerpen en je hebt een bult aan componenten tot je beschikking. Zelf maak ik gebruik van Altium en dat blijft toch wel het mooiste pakket.
https://www.altium.com/circuitmaker

Thevel

Golden Member

Ik heb zelf jaren Designspark gebruikt maar sinds een paar jaar gebruik ik KiCad.
Persoonlijk vind ik Designspark als beginner eenvoudiger dan KiCad.

Maak je ontwerp dubbelzijdig, er zijn printboeren waar je meer moet betalen voor een enkelzijdige print dan een dubbelzijdige.

Printen laten maken is eenvoudig, ik heb zelf al meerdere printen laten maken bij JLCPCB.
Je laat het PCB programma de gerber files generen (dat zijn er al gauw een stuk of 10!), van die files maak je 1 ZIP-file.
Even een account aanmaken en de ZIP-file binnen halen en je ziet onmiddellijk hoe de print er uit gaat zien.

[Bericht gewijzigd door Thevel op donderdag 3 februari 2022 23:57:06 (39%)

Ik heb vroeger altijd net Eagle en Altium getekend (voor mij is Altium nog steeds het mooiste pakket), maar sinds een paar maanden teken ik met KiCAD, en dat werkt best goed, en in tegenstelling tot Eagle en Altium is dat pakket gratis. Er zit ook een grote library van componenten bij, en nieuwe maken of importeren is heel eenvoudig.

Een manager is iemand die denkt dat negen vrouwen in één maand een kind kunnen maken
EricP

mét CE

Heel lang geleden, ben ik begonnen met Eagle. En daar werk ik eigenlijk nog steeds mee. Inmiddels wel met een 'antieke' versie die het gewoon doet zonder abonnement :). Iets 'in the cloud' is hoe dan ook niet bespreekbaar.

KiCad heb ik wel eens geprobeerd. Ik vond het vooral heel veel gedoe. Alhoewel in de paar avonden dat ik er mee heb zitten spelen het wel laat zien dat het heel veel kan (of je dat allemaal nodig hebt?)

Als het voor iets eenmaligs is en zo klein... Dan wil iemand hier dat toch wel ff tekeken? Als je de gerbers hebt, dan kun je bij elke willekeurige PCB boer de zooi bestellen. Zelfs op de bij jou zo geliefde internetchinees kan dat (wel een gedaan, de kwaliteit is iets minder dan bij seeed, maar sneller en goedkoper en prima bruikbaar. De 'wat mindere' kwaliteit kwam door een experimenteerboard. Die van seeed kunnen dat gewoon. Deze kreeg toch last van loslatende eilandjes als je er de 30ste keer aan soldeert).

Wat je zelf moet aanleveren: schets van het schema, welke componenten ('een weerstand' is een erg rekbaar begrip tegenwoordig) en de layout (ofwel: outline en waar evt. gaatjes voor bevestiging moeten zitten en of je daar nog 'clearnce' nodig hebt.
Routeren is doorgaans het meeste werk. Maar met een hand vol componenten en double sided zonder 'hf' kan het niet spannend zijn.

Op 3 februari 2022 22:47:28 schreef benleentje:
[...]Ik had nog nooit een pcb getekend. IK ben zelf begonnen met Eagle, voor zover ik kon zien de meest uitgebreide bibliotheek en tot 80cm2 dubbelzijdig, onbeperkte pinnen en bijna alle tools zijn ook te gebruiken en ook auto-routing ed.

ik heb op school destijds moeten leren om een schema te tekenen, en daarvan een pcb maken op pc. maar dat is nooit in praktijk uitgewerkt geweest. was de les tekenen.

de printen die ik toen maakte voor mijn eindwerk, waren afdrukte afbeeldingen, dan met alcoholstift nog aanpassingen op tekenen, transparanten mee maken, en met 1 of ander belichtingsapparaat op een lichtgevoelige print.
dat was ook maar 1malig voor de les.
de effectie printen hebben we gemaakt door toner te transfereren op print (wat ook niet echt goed werkte) en door transparanten te printen, bijkleuren met alcoholstift, op een lichtgevoelige print leggen, belichten met UV buislampen en dan etsen in de etsbak.

ik vond dat zo een heel gedoe voor een print, dat ik het op die tijd op gaatjesprint maak, en zo werk ik al 20jaar.

omdat ik nu meerdere dezelfde wil maken, is het handiger toch een print te maken. het grootste deel aanpassingen zit toch in software in de arduino

ik hou van werken ..., ik kan er uren naar kijken
bprosman

Golden Member

Op 3 februari 2022 22:58:42 schreef Mrtn1988:
Ik zou Altium Circuitmaker adviseren. Dat is gratis voor een paar ontwerpen en je hebt een bult aan componenten tot je beschikking. Zelf maak ik gebruik van Altium en dat blijft toch wel het mooiste pakket.
https://www.altium.com/circuitmaker

Altium is nog steeds "de top" maar wat doe je als je meer dan "een paar ontwerpen" maakt ? Voor zover ik weet is een abbo stinkduur.
Heb veel met zijn voorganger Protel gewerkt.
Ik ben net als EricP en _GJ geen voorstander van een "Cloud abonnementsoplossing".
(Wil niet zeggen dat ik niet voor software wil betalen).

[Bericht gewijzigd door bprosman op vrijdag 4 februari 2022 11:02:23 (12%)

De jongere generatie loopt veel te vaak zijn PIC achterna.
EricP

mét CE

Altium ken ik van 'mee zien werken'. Het kan hele mooie dingen. Daarin is het veel flexibeler dan eagle etc. Aan de andere kant zegt ik dan: dingen als impedance matchting en autorouting is misschien leuk als je (werderom een dwarsstraat) een mainboard voor een PC ontwerpt.
Voor een l*llig printje (zonder daarmee TS persoonlijk te bedoelen) waar max 20MHz voorbij komt, wat op een halve briefkaart past en routeren op de hand minder tijd kost dan de auto-router temmen kan het in elk geval qua kosten niet uit.

Voor zover ik weet, waren de abonnements-loze versies van Eagle voor 'eigen gebruik' op beperkt oppervlak gewoon gratis te gebruiken (als in: mocht van Cadsoft). Waarschijnlijk was het hun manier van marktaandeel kopen.

Als de prijs in verhouding is tot wat ik er mee doe... prima om er wat voor te betalen. En al helemaal als je het 'zakelijk' gebruikt.

Mijn eerste PCBtjes waren gewoon met de merkstift getekend. En dan zo in bad. En soms maakte je er eentje in spiegelbeeld :(
Luxer waren al de 'wrijfsymbolen'. Dan klopte een IC voet ook exact. En toen het transparant-met-belichten werd was dat helemaal luxe (nog steeds... wrijfsymbolen en viltstift om de transparanten te maken.
Toen kwam Protel. Afdrukken op transparant en daarmee verder. Daarna kwam Eagle. En meestal besteed ik het nu uit (gewoon omdat het niet 'uit' kan om het zelf te doen). Tenzij het 'nu' moet (niet heel raar in wat ik doe). Daarmee doe ik steeds meer SMD. Wel wat meer gepiel met monteren, maar geen gaatjes meer boren.

Ik heb het spul niet 'startklaar' staan. Maar als ik het ontwerp eenmaal heb... Ik denk dat ik binnen een half uur wel een PCB kan produceren. Moet je 'm alleen nog ff boren. Zo veel gedoe is het niet.

Maar goed... Terug naar het begin: wat wil je maken?
Als in: een tekentool leren kennen is leuk, maar als het daadwerkelijk eenmalig is, dan ben je ruim meer tijd bezig met die tool dan met je PCB...

dat kicad wordt maar niks, die zit zich veel teveel te moeien met de routing en het wordt te ingewikkeld dat ik er zelf niet aan uit geraak. ook 'verspringen' de componenten naar plaatsen waar het niet hoor. die schakelaar springt altijd exact naar het midden van de arduino, terwijl die iets meer aan kant moet omdat er een weerstand naast komt.

de footprint van de arduino moet ook gespiegeld worden aangezien mijn print op de achterkant van de arduino komt en alle componenten ertussen moeten blijven.

ik heb dus eerder een programma nodig waar ik de footprints kan in laden en waar ik zelf de verbindingen kan tekenen. ik ben weer naar de oude stijl terug gekeerd met pen en papier.

bestaat er geen gaatjes print (softwarematig) waar je dan gaatjes kan 'verwijderen' en bepaalde 'verbindingen' kan tekenen en dit exporteren als een print?

[Bericht gewijzigd door fcapri op vrijdag 4 februari 2022 12:02:39 (13%)

ik hou van werken ..., ik kan er uren naar kijken
bprosman

Golden Member

Stuur anders eens wat je hebt als je wil (Kicad ontwerp).
Ik wil wel meekijken.
(mailadres staat openbaar).

de footprint van de arduino moet ook gespiegeld worden aangezien mijn print op de achterkant van de arduino komt en alle componenten ertussen moeten blijven.

Dat is niet zo heel ingewikkeld, maar als je de footprint aan de "achterkant" van de print plakt spiegelt hij automatisch.

[Bericht gewijzigd door bprosman op vrijdag 4 februari 2022 12:12:09 (58%)

De jongere generatie loopt veel te vaak zijn PIC achterna.
Rob W.

Honourable Member

Voor zo af en toe eens wat te maken kun je ook eens naar EasyEDA kijken. Web-based, niets te installeren en er is best makkelijk mee te werken.. (ik kan het ook..)
https://easyeda.com/editor
Van daaruit is het ook simpel om een pcb te bestellen, of de gerbers te downloaden.. net wat je wil. Pcb's worden gemaakt door JLCPCB, zijn niet duur en leveren netjes en vlot.

Just my 2 cents :)

Leest mee sinds 19 augustus 2001..